1. Important Safety Information

Please read all instructions carefully before assembly and use of the Safety 1st Extra Wide Baby Gate. Failure to follow these instructions could result in serious injury or death.

  • This gate is designed for children 6-24 months of age and is also suitable for pets.
  • WARNING: Never use this pressure-mounted gate at the top of stairs. It is intended for use in doorways, hallways, and at the bottom of stairs only.
  • Always install with the provided wall cups to ensure the gate remains securely in place.
  • Regularly check all parts for proper assembly and tightness.
  • Do not use if any components are missing or damaged.
  • Keep small parts away from children during assembly.

3. Setup and Installation

The Safety 1st Extra Wide Baby Gate features an easy, pressure-mounted installation that requires no drilling. It adjusts to fit openings between 29 to 47 inches wide and stands 36 inches tall.

3.1 Determine Placement and Width

Measure your doorway or opening. Select the appropriate number of extension panels to achieve the desired width. The gate is designed to fit snugly within the opening.

3.2 Assemble Gate with Extensions

Attach any necessary extension panels to the main gate frame. Ensure they click securely into place.

3.3 Install Tension Rods and Wall Cups

Insert the four tension rods into the corners of the gate frame. Place the wall cups against the wall or door frame at the desired height. Rotate the adjustment wheels on the tension rods to extend them until they make firm contact with the wall cups. Continue tightening until the gate is securely held in place and the SecureTech indicator shows green.

4. Operating Instructions

The gate features a walk-through design with a SecureTech locking system for ease of use and enhanced safety.

4.1 Opening the Gate

To open the gate, slide the button on the top rail forward and simultaneously push the button on the bottom of the handle. This two-action mechanism is designed to be difficult for children to operate.

4.2 Closing and Locking the Gate

Simply push the gate door closed. It will automatically latch. The SecureTech indicator on the top rail will show green when the gate is securely locked, providing visual confirmation of safety. If the indicator shows red, the gate is not securely locked and needs to be adjusted or re-closed.

4.3 Gate Swing Direction

The gate door can swing in either direction. A stopper mechanism at the bottom allows you to restrict the swing to one direction if desired, which can be useful in certain locations.

5. Maintenance

To keep your Safety 1st baby gate in optimal condition:

  • Clean with a mild soap and damp cloth. Do not use abrasive cleaners or strong chemicals.
  • Periodically check all connections and tension rods to ensure they remain tight and secure.
  • Inspect the gate for any signs of wear, damage, or loose parts. Discontinue use if any damage is found.

6.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your gate, try the following:

  • Gate not closing/latching properly: Ensure the gate is installed squarely within the opening. Loosen the tension rods slightly, adjust the gate's position, and then re-tighten. Check the SecureTech indicator for green.
  • Gate feels loose: Re-tighten all four tension rods until the gate is firm and the SecureTech indicator shows green. Ensure wall cups are properly installed.
  • Difficulty opening the gate: Ensure you are performing both actions (sliding the top button and pushing the bottom button) simultaneously.
